Optical Bistability in a SOA/DFB-LD Feedback Scheme

Not Accessible

Your library or personal account may give you access

Abstract

Optical bistability is investigated using a DFB laser diode connected with a SOA. Broadband operation and tunability of the domain of bistable responses is shown. The device can readily serve as an all-optical flip-flop.
